Goring-by-Sea station is equipped with a variety of facilities to ensure your travel is comfortable and convenient.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with both a ticket office and accessible ticket machines available, including facilities for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. These machines are accessible by design, although it's wise to review the station map regarding accessibility.
Despite the lack of waiting rooms or first-class lounges, there are ample seating areas to rest while waiting for your train. You'll also find dedicated spaces for bicycle storage, handy for cycling enthusiasts who use their bikes to commute to and from the station. Free parking is available at the station, operated by APCOA Parking UK, including specific spaces reserved for those with accessibility needs.
The station provides several accessibility measures, including step-free access and assistance ramps for train access. Assistance by friendly station staff can be arranged in advance or on a 'turn up and go' basis during operating hours. Although the station lacks some amenities like accessible toilets or baby changing facilities, the travel assistance features make navigating the station manageable for those needing support.

Ravensbourne Station is equipped to handle your ticketing needs efficiently, making travel planning less cumbersome. The ticket office is open Monday to Friday from 06:40 to 13:20. If you are traveling outside these hours, don’t fret—automated ticket machines are available, and they support online ticket collection. These machines are accessible and offer discounts for travelers with a Disabled Persons Railcard, although it’s important to check the station map for step-free access to ensure a smooth journey.
Although the station lacks some conveniences such as waiting rooms or toilets, it compensates with functional seating areas and customer help points for any queries. If you're worried about security, rest assured, as all areas are monitored by CCTV. Ravensbourne also strives to be inclusive with features like induction loops and staff assistance available during ticket office hours.
